** The kitchen remodeling market in Eagle River, Wisconsin, reflects its Northwoods setting. The market is characterized by a mix of older cabins and homes needing full modernizations and newer constructions or second homes seeking high-end upgrades. Due to the city's size, there are only a handful of dedicated remodeling firms based directly in Eagle River, with the most prominent being **Northwoods Custom Remodeling**. Consequently, homeowners often rely on reputable contractors from nearby hubs like Rhinelander and Minocqua, who regularly service the Eagle River area. Competition is moderate but specialized; the contractors who thrive are those with proven reputations for reliability and quality craftsmanship. Pricing is typically above the national average, reflecting the custom nature of the work, the challenges of sourcing materials to a rural area, and the high demand for skilled labor. Homeowners should expect a significant range in quotes, but for a full, mid-range kitchen remodel, budgets often start in the $35,000 - $75,000+ range, with high-end projects easily exceeding $100,000. The market is also highly seasonal, with peak demand during the spring and summer months.

For a full remodel in Eagle River, homeowners can expect a typical range of $25,000 to $60,000+, depending on scope and material choices. Local factors like the need to coordinate with tradespeople who may travel from Rhinelander or Wausau can add to labor costs, and choosing materials suited for our climate—such as durable flooring that handles humidity shifts—can impact the budget. It's also wise to budget for potential discoveries behind walls in older Northwoods cabins and homes.
The ideal timeline is to plan and order materials during the quieter fall or late winter months, with construction ideally occurring in spring or early fall to avoid both the peak summer tourism season (when contractors are busiest) and the deepest winter freeze. Our harsh winters can delay material deliveries, and scheduling during summer can be difficult as many local contractors are also managing rental property turnovers and urgent repairs for seasonal residents.
Yes, if your home is within the City of Eagle River, you'll need a permit for structural, electrical, and plumbing work, which must adhere to Wisconsin Uniform Dwelling Code (UDC). A critical local consideration is if your property is on a septic system; Vilas County has strict regulations, and changing your kitchen layout or adding a garbage disposal may require a review by the Vilas County Zoning and Sanitation Department to ensure your system can handle the load.
Prioritize contractors with extensive local experience who are familiar with the common structural features of Northwoods homes, such as log construction or older foundations. Verify they are properly licensed and insured in Wisconsin. It's also highly beneficial to choose a provider with established relationships with local suppliers and sub-contractors, as this network is crucial for navigating material lead times and scheduling in our region.
Opt for materials that withstand temperature fluctuations and periods of lower occupancy. Quartz countertops resist stains and don't require sealing, while luxury vinyl plank flooring handles humidity well and is durable. For cabinets, consider plywood boxes (not particleboard) and full-overlay doors with a durable finish. Avoid solid wood flooring that may gap with humidity changes, and ensure ventilation is adequate to prevent moisture buildup when the home is closed up.
